OREANDA-NEWS. September 23, 2010. On September 8, during the 6th Baikal economic forum in Irkutsk, JSC Irkutskenergo and JSC Gazprombank signed the agreement on the preliminary conditions of the construction of heat pump system (HPS) with the capacity of 1.25 Gcalh and of accompanying infrastructure at the Baikalsk CHPP production site. This is the pilot project of the company in the area of clean technologies of Baikalsk energy supply. HPS for the heat production and supply into the town will use the drain water of Baikalsk sewage treatment plants. The decision on the installation of the HPS in Baikalsk and including it into the town’s heating system inflow scheme was made during the search of eco-friendly heat sources. The HPS project is realized by JSC Irkutskenergo accompanied by Finnish companies Scancool and Avanko Capital and with the support of Dmitry Mezentsev, the Irkutsk region governor.

Evgeny Fedorov, CEO of JSC Irkutskenergo: ”This is the first stage of the socially significant project for the Irkutsk region. It is planned to be finished before the start of the 2011 heating season. When this pilot project is tested in Baikalsk, its realization will be possible in other towns of the region”.
